Output eba02aebb4ab4bee81f2ad9ff2af2ce6db9937cf8aa8f3d3bcaa448df4fbf0f6:0

value
2440987
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77b86b7d143ce5064e006b5d5ca7d79b06bcd58b OP_EQUAL
address
3Cc3G68cuWJgbLuMRCrW2oNc7ce6THnp9z
transaction
eba02aebb4ab4bee81f2ad9ff2af2ce6db9937cf8aa8f3d3bcaa448df4fbf0f6
confirmations
421034
spent
true